As per We Got This Covered, Disney has already earned $4 Billion total ticket sales, regardless of the numerous big budget flops the studio has suffered this year. While official confirmation on these numbers is awaited, one cannot deny that the studio has again haled its position strong and refuses to leave it anytime soon.
To list down the flops, Disney saw the biggest Marvel flop with Ant-Man & The Wasp: Quantumania, followed by Indiana Jones And The Dial Of Destiny being labelled as one of the heftiest flops in the history of cinema. There was also Haunted Mansion that is right now exploring rock bottom. Only Guardians Of The Galaxy Vol 3 was the saving grace, and Little Mermaid is yet to release with not very impressive predictions. The report says that the above-mentioned movies probably have cost Disney a $300 million loss. Each one of it was easily made at budgets of around $150 Million, excluding the marketing cost.
